Arts and Crafts movement Wikipedia ~ The Arts and Crafts movement was an international movement in the decorative and fine arts that began in Britain and flourished in Europe and North America between about 1880 and 1920 emerging in Japan the Mingei movement in the 1920s It stood for traditional craftsmanship using simple forms and often used medieval romantic or folk styles of decoration
Architectural Style Edwardian building history ~ Edwardian architecture 190114 The Victorian battle of the styles had ended in an eclectic aesthetic The classical tradition burst into Baroque public buildings such as Cardiff City Hall 18971906 by Lanchester and Edwin Rickards Domes were especially popular Notice the asymmetrically placed tower This added a Picturesque touch to an otherwise classical design
Ascott House Wikipedia ~ Ascott House sometimes referred to as simply Ascott is a Grade II listed building in the hamlet of Ascott near Wing in Buckinghamshire is set in a 3200acre 13 km 2 estate Ascott House was originally a farm house built in the reign of James I and known as Ascott Hall In 1873 it was acquired by Baron Mayer de Rothschild of the neighbouring Mentmore Towers estate
